Gathering interface statistics can be a relatively expensive operation
on certain systems as it requires iterating over all the cpus.
RTEXT_FILTER_SKIP_STATS was first introduced [1] to skip AF_INET6
statistics from interface dumps and it was then extended [2] to
also exclude IFLA_VF_INFO.
The semantics of the flag does not seem to be limited to AF_INET
or VF statistics and having a way to query the interface status
(e.g: carrier, address) without retrieving its statistics seems
reasonable. So this patch extends the use RTEXT_FILTER_SKIP_STATS
to also affect IFLA_STATS.

diff --git a/net/core/rtnetlink.c b/net/core/rtnetlink.c
index 8040ff7c356e..aa09d026817b 100644
--- a/net/core/rtnetlink.c
+++ b/net/core/rtnetlink.c
@@ -1275,8 +1275,9 @@ static noinline size_t if_nlmsg_size(const struct net_device *dev,
+ nla_total_size(IFALIASZ) /* IFLA_IFALIAS */
+ nla_total_size(IFNAMSIZ) /* IFLA_QDISC */
+ nla_total_size_64bit(sizeof(struct rtnl_link_ifmap))
- + nla_total_size(sizeof(struct rtnl_link_stats))
- + nla_total_size_64bit(sizeof(struct rtnl_link_stats64))
+ + ((ext_filter_mask & RTEXT_FILTER_SKIP_STATS) ? 0 :
+ (nla_total_size(sizeof(struct rtnl_link_stats)) +
+ nla_total_size_64bit(sizeof(struct rtnl_link_stats64))))
+ nla_total_size(MAX_ADDR_LEN) /* IFLA_ADDRESS */
+ nla_total_size(MAX_ADDR_LEN) /* IFLA_BROADCAST */
+ nla_total_size(4) /* IFLA_TXQLEN */
@@ -2123,7 +2124,8 @@ static int rtnl_fill_ifinfo(struct sk_buff *skb,
if (rtnl_phys_switch_id_fill(skb, dev))
goto nla_put_failure;
- if (rtnl_fill_stats(skb, dev))
+ if (!(ext_filter_mask & RTEXT_FILTER_SKIP_STATS) &&
+ rtnl_fill_stats(skb, dev))
goto nla_put_failure;
if (rtnl_fill_vf(skb, dev, ext_filter_mask))
